Web1 de dic. de 2007 · You may need to enable the onboard sata controller in the bios,it should do an extra sata setup thing on post and say press ctrl+f2 or summat similar to access the sata setup. EDIT-just looked at the manual,you need to enable the promise raid in onboard devices (i think) then set it to raid and press CTRL+F to enter the setup during the post. K tamper witness 2f case
